Re parking. It all got a bit weary I`m afraid. Pulled in at the front of the Museum and went in to ask about the best place to park, thinking there might be a nice little spot for two bikes. But no-one was particularly helpful, so went round the block and pulled in on some space outside their café which looked ideal, however, got told to move them (the ladies in the café thought having the bikes there was fun and were very chatty, they thought being told to move was a bit jobs worth). The one thing they were helpful about was telling me we would be ticketed if we parked on the pavement. But we ended up on the pavement by some pedal cycle bays opposite the Café Portico. Didn`t get ticketed. I think someone has put that location in as a parking spot on an earlier entry. This is at Flaxengate j/w Grantham Street. There are 2 pay and display car parks very close by but they are quite small and were full up, one is opposite the entrance to the Museum in Danes Terrace, the other is at the back of the museum in Danesgate. It took longer to park than it did to go round the exhibition. Still the café there is fine.
